Baixe o app para aproveitar ainda mais
Prévia do material em texto
01/04/2021 UNIFANOR: Alunos https://simulado.unifanor.com.br/alunos/ 1/5 Disc.: BANCO DE DADOS Aluno(a): FRANCISCA SHIRLANE SAMPAIO DE LIMA RIBEIRO 202051231807 Acertos: 10,0 de 10,0 01/04/2021 Acerto: 1,0 / 1,0 Os primeiros sistemas de bancos de dados implementados na década de 1960, como o IDS e o IMS, usavam, respectivamente, estruturas de dados em redes e em árvores, por isso, são conhecidos como bancos de dados: conceituais de arquivos de esquemas navegacionais relacionais Respondido em 01/04/2021 09:56:36 Acerto: 1,0 / 1,0 Qual conjunto de comandos da SQL abaixo serve para o administrador do banco de dados gerenciar os metadados de um banco de dados? INSERT, UPDATE, DELETE CREATE, MODIFY, DELETE CREATE, ALTER, DROP Questão1 a Questão2 a https://simulado.unifanor.com.br/alunos/inicio.asp javascript:voltar(); 01/04/2021 UNIFANOR: Alunos https://simulado.unifanor.com.br/alunos/ 2/5 CREATE, ALTER, DELETE INSERT, ALTER, REMOVE Respondido em 01/04/2021 10:00:24 Acerto: 1,0 / 1,0 Na nomenclatura de banco de dados, restrição corresponde a uma regra que deve ser obedecida pelo SGBD. Seja a restrição "um funcionário não pode ter salário maior que seu chefe imediato", esta deve ser classificada como restrição de: Domínio Chave Semântica Unicidade Tabela Respondido em 01/04/2021 10:00:30 Acerto: 1,0 / 1,0 (ESAF - 2010 - SUSEP - Analista Técnico - Prova 2 - Tecnologia da Informação) Em relação aos conceitos de bancos de dados, é correto afirmar que: Um atributo não pode possuir cardinalidade Um relacionamento não pode possuir cardinalidade Um atributo pode possuir cardinalidade de relacionamentos Em uma generalização/especialização total, para cada ocorrência da entidade genérica, existe sempre uma ocorrência em uma das entidades especializadas O conjunto de valores que um atributo pode assumir é a cardinalidade do atributo Respondido em 01/04/2021 10:00:52 Acerto: 1,0 / 1,0 (Tribunal Regional Eleitoral do Rio Grande do Norte (TRE/RN) 2011 - Cargo: Analista Judiciário - Área Analista de Sistemas) Formar novas relações, separando-as a partir de grupos de repetição antes existentes dentro de uma relação, é objetivo da: Questão3 a Questão4 a Questão5 a 01/04/2021 UNIFANOR: Alunos https://simulado.unifanor.com.br/alunos/ 3/5 2FN FNBC 1FN 3FN 5FN Respondido em 01/04/2021 10:01:22 Acerto: 1,0 / 1,0 (Tribunal Regional do Trabalho da 23ª Região (TRT 23) 2016 - Analista Judiciário - Área Apoio Especializado - Especialidade: Tecnologia da Informação Banca: Fundação Carlos Chagas (FCC)) São vários os tipos de dados numéricos no PostgreSQL. O tipo: bigint é a escolha usual para números inteiros, pois oferece o melhor equilíbrio entre faixa de valores, tamanho de armazenamento e desempenho. integer tem tamanho de armazenamento de 4 bytes e pode armazenar valores na faixa de −32768 a 32767. smallint tem tamanho de armazenamento de 1 byte, que permite armazenar a faixa de valores inteiros de −128 a 127. serial é um tipo conveniente para definir colunas identificadoras únicas, semelhante à propriedade auto incremento. numeric pode armazenar números com precisão variável de, no máximo, 100 dígitos. Respondido em 01/04/2021 10:02:03 Explicação: ... Acerto: 1,0 / 1,0 (Agência de Fomento do Amapá (AFAP) - Tecnologia da Informação - FCC (2019)) Fernando está usando a linguagem SQL (ANSI) e pretende fazer uma atualização nos dados Nome_Cli e End_Cli do cliente cujo Cod_Cli é Cli01, na tabela Cliente. Nome_Cli passará a ser Ariana e End_Cli passará a ser Rua ABC. O código SQL correto que Fernando escreveu foi: I.. Cliente II.. Nome_Cli = 'Ariana', End _Cli = 'Rua ABC' III.. Cod_Cli = 'Cli01'; Para que o código esteja correto, as lacunas I, II e III devem ser preenchidas, respectivamente, por Questão6 a Questão7 a 01/04/2021 UNIFANOR: Alunos https://simulado.unifanor.com.br/alunos/ 4/5 SET - UPDATE - WHERE WHERE - SET - UPDATE UPDATE - SET - WHERE SET - WHERE - UPDATE UPDATE - WHERE - SET Respondido em 01/04/2021 10:02:25 Acerto: 1,0 / 1,0 Seja uma tabela assim estruturada: UNIDADE(CODIGOU, DESCRICAO, BAIRRO, ANOINICIO). Qual código a seguir retorna as unidades localizadas nos bairros Copacabana, Centro ou Barra, cujo ano de início de funcionamento seja maior 2002? SELECT * FROM UNIDADE WHERE BAIRRO NOT IN ('Copacabana','Centro','Barra') AND ANOINICIO=2002 SELECT * FROM UNIDADE WHERE BAIRRO IN ('Copacabana','Centro','Barra') AND ANOINICIO=2002 SELECT * FROM UNIDADE WHERE BAIRRO NOT IN ('Copacabana','Centro','Barra') AND ANOINICIO>2002 SELECT * FROM UNIDADE WHERE BAIRRO IN ('Copacabana','Centro','Barra') AND ANOINICIO>2002 SELECT * FROM UNIDADE WHERE BAIRRO LIKE ('Copacabana','Centro','Barra') AND ANOINICIO>2002 Respondido em 01/04/2021 10:05:03 Acerto: 1,0 / 1,0 Sejam duas tabelas assim estruturadas: DEPARTAMENTO(CODIGOD, NOME) EMPREGADO(CODIGOE, NOME, ENDERECO, CODIGOD) CODIGOD REFERENCIA DEPARTAMENTO Seja a consulta a seguir: SELECT D.NOME, E.NOME FROM DEPARTAMENTO D LEFT JOIN EMPREGADO E ON (D.CODIGOD=E.CODIGOD) ORDER BY D.NOME; A consulta retorna: O nome do departamento e o nome do empregado alocado. Os empregados sem departamento e os departamentos sem empregado aparecem nos resultados. O nome do departamento e o nome do empregado alocado. Os empregados sem departamento não aparecem no resultado. O nome do departamento e o nome do empregado alocado. Os empregados sem departamento aparecem no resultado. O nome do departamento e o nome do empregado alocado. Os departamentos sem funcionário aparecem no resultado. Questão8 a Questão9 a 01/04/2021 UNIFANOR: Alunos https://simulado.unifanor.com.br/alunos/ 5/5 O nome do departamento e o nome do empregado alocado. Os departamentos sem funcionário alocado não aparecem no resultado. Respondido em 01/04/2021 10:07:32 Explicação: Acerto: 1,0 / 1,0 Prova: ESAF - 2004 - CGU - Analista de Finanças e Controle - Tecnologia da Informação - Prova 3) Na linguagem SQL, a consulta simples a um Banco de Dados é uma instrução SELECT e a consulta composta inclui duas ou mais instruções SELECT. Com relação às consultas com a utilização da linguagem SQL é correto afirmar que o operador: INTERSECT é usado para combinar duas instruções SELECT, retornando somente as linhas da primeira instrução SELECT que sejam idênticas a uma linha da segunda instrução SELECT. UNION é usado para combinar os resultados de duas ou mais instruções SELECT, retornando linhas duplicadas EXCEPT, quando usado na combinação duas instruções SELECT, a ordem das instruções SELECT não altera o resultado da consulta UNION ALL, quando usado na combinação de duas instruções SELECT, a ordem das instruções SELECT altera o resultado da consulta EXCEPT é usado para combinar duas ou mais instruções SELECT, retornando somente as linhas da primeira instrução SELECT que sejam semelhantes a uma linha das demais instruções. Respondido em 01/04/2021 10:08:21 Questão10 a javascript:abre_colabore('38403','220688279','4450749296');
Compartilhar